#1 Boneyard Match - WWE WrestleMania 36

The very first cinematic match that WWE presented in 2020 was the Boneyard match between The Undertaker and AJ Styles. This WrestleMania headliner (it headlined Night 1) set a standard so high for the cinematic matches in WWE that no other bout has been able to surpass it. An intriguing storyline revolving around Styles ripping off the kayfabe that The Undertaker has maintained for years now did its job in getting the fans excited for this fight.
The match itself, along with the setting, the background music, and the Buried Alive stipulation, was a visual treat. In what was one of the better bouts that The Phenom has had over the years, we saw The Undertaker bring with him The Unholy Trinity (The Undertaker gimmick, The American Badass Gimmick, and the man Mark Calaway himself) to fight Styles and his Good Brothers.

The Undertaker burying Styles, before doing his signature fist raise, and riding off was perhaps the perfect retirement that The Phenom could have had, and we can only say one thing: Thank You, Taker.
